Vegan eggs and regular eggs have different nutritional qualities. The current recommendations for regular eggs by the American Heart Association is one egg a day. Vegan eggs have benefits such as fiber and no cholesterol. Pour 1/4 cup of the mung bean egg batter on the heated skillet (this makes 1 egg).Sep 8, 2019 · 2. Chia Seeds. Similar to flaxseed meal, you can also use chia seeds or ground chia powder to replace eggs in vegan baking. Made the same way flax eggs are made, chia eggs have an equally nice texture but can change the color of your baked goods slightly because of their dark color. In order to understand why eggs are not vegan you need to understand two basic things: That eggs come from animals and hence are ‘animal products’. That vegans do not consume animal products. Many vegetarians consume eggs on the basis that they are not technically the ‘flesh’ of animals, and they could be referred to as an ‘ovo ...
